package com.ruoyi.project.tr.hiddenTroubleType.service; import java.util.List; import com.ruoyi.project.tr.hiddenTroubleType.domain.HiddenTroubleType; /** * 隐患类型Service接口 * * @author wm * @date 2020-05-05 */ public interface IHiddenTroubleTypeService { /** * 查询隐患类型 * * @param hiddenTroubleTypeId 隐患类型ID * @return 隐患类型 */ HiddenTroubleType selectHiddenTroubleTypeById(Long hiddenTroubleTypeId); /** * 查询隐患类型列表 * * @param hiddenTroubleType 隐患类型 * @return 隐患类型集合 */ List selectHiddenTroubleTypeList(HiddenTroubleType hiddenTroubleType); /** * 新增隐患类型 * * @param hiddenTroubleType 隐患类型 * @return 结果 */ int insertHiddenTroubleType(HiddenTroubleType hiddenTroubleType); /** * 修改隐患类型 * * @param hiddenTroubleType 隐患类型 * @return 结果 */ int updateHiddenTroubleType(HiddenTroubleType hiddenTroubleType); /** * 批量删除隐患类型 * * @param ids 需要删除的数据ID * @return 结果 */ int deleteHiddenTroubleTypeByIds(String ids); /** * 删除隐患类型信息 * * @param hiddenTroubleTypeId 隐患类型ID * @return 结果 */ int deleteHiddenTroubleTypeById(Long hiddenTroubleTypeId); }